During the 14.2 rollout window, the Meridline Scheduler detected duplicate event writes between the Hollowbrook calendar service and the legacy Tavenor sync bridge. Affected events show conflicting timestamps and may appear twice for users in the Pellworth region. The conflict resolver has paused automatic merges pending manual review, so no data has been lost, but release sign-off should be delayed until reconciliation completes. If you need conflict logs or a status update before the go/no-go call, reach out to the sync team directly.

alerts address for bajop-yahog: istwyn@lumiclabs.internal

**Quarterly Planning Note – Ostermann Retail Pilot**

The pilot with the Ostermann grocery chain begins next quarter across twelve stores in the Ravenport area. Objectives: validate shelf-edge pricing units and measure restocking time savings. Hardware allocation is confirmed; installation crews are booked. Department heads should flag resourcing conflicts by month-end. Success criteria and exit terms are agreed. One confidential point of context follows below.

management briefing: Project Ulavan slips by two quarters because of the staffing delay.

# Break-Glass: Catalog Cache Invalidation

Scope: the Pinrow product catalog at Veldstone Retail. If stale prices persist after a purge and the Hollowmere invalidation queue is wedged, use break-glass to flush the edge tier directly. Contractors: get verbal sign-off from the catalog lead first. Steps: open the Hollowmere admin shell, select emergency-flush, confirm the tenant, and run it once — repeated flushes thrash the origin. Access is logged and expires after 20 minutes. Unseal the admin shell with the passphrase below.

recovery phrase for kahop-tajog: istix-casvan

## Pagination basics

Quick note for review: the public Lanternly REST API uses cursor pagination — grab `next_cursor` from each response and pass it back. To test against the internal mirror instance, you'll need to authenticate first. The key for the mirror service is right below.

service key, fawip-bajef: kto11_Qt5wZK9vdNC